SB 279

Alabama Senate bill in Session 2026RS.

Status: enacted. Latest action: April 9, 2026.

General Contractor Licensing Board; practice of general contracting, exemption expanded.

Summary

This act amends Section 34-8-7, Code of Alabama 1975, to exempt the following services and types of work from the requirement to be licensed as a general contractor: (1) repairing a residence or private dwelling; (2) constructing or repairing a residential swimming pool; (3) pressure washing; (4) maintaining, repairing, or removing security systems, lighting, filter systems, plumbing, air conditioning, electrical systems, and existing paint; and (5) routine cleaning, waste disposal, and janitorial services.
